English noun: avalanche

1. avalanche (event) a slide of large masses of snow and ice and mud down a mountain

Broader (hypernym)slide

Narrower (hyponym)lahar

2. avalanche (event) a sudden appearance of an overwhelming number of things

SamplesThe program brought an avalanche of mail.

Broader (hypernym)happening, natural event, occurrence, occurrent

English verb: avalanche

1. avalanche (motion) gather into a huge mass and roll down a mountain, of snow

Synonymsroll down

Pattern of useSomething ----s

Broader (hypernym)come down, descend, fall, go down

